The Nonprofit Tech Picture

In more than 400 social change groups:

• 59% report are frustrated or really struggling with technology.

• More funding is not the most important factor in satisfaction with technology.

• Having enough tech staff is the most important factor.

Page 5: Foundations and Futures: Nonprofit Technology 2012

• What do we need? Communications and fund raising tools, we said.

• 47% do not have online donations from their web sites.

• Over 50% have inadequate data management– slips of paper, Excel spreadsheets, personal address books to manage contacts/donors/ content yet 70% consider it important.
